
The Ten of Cups tarot meaning represents complete emotional fulfillment, family harmony, and lasting happiness. This card signals the achievement of your deepest emotional desires and the blessing of authentic connection with loved ones.
The Ten of Cups represents the pinnacle of emotional satisfaction and domestic bliss. When this card appears, it often signals that you've reached a place of genuine contentment in your personal relationships and home life. This isn't fleeting happiness but rather the deep, sustained joy that comes from authentic connection and shared values. The card suggests that your emotional investments are paying off beautifully, creating a foundation of love and support that nourishes everyone involved. You may find yourself surrounded by people who truly understand and appreciate you, creating an atmosphere of mutual care and celebration. This energy extends beyond romantic partnerships to encompass chosen family, close friendships, and community bonds that feel genuinely supportive. The Ten of Cups reminds us that true wealth lies in these meaningful relationships and the sense of belonging they provide.
In romantic contexts, the Ten of Cups signals deep partnership harmony and the potential for lasting commitment. This card often appears when couples have moved beyond surface attraction into genuine compatibility and shared life vision. You may be experiencing that rare feeling of being completely understood and accepted by your partner. For those seeking love, this card suggests that meaningful connection could be approaching, particularly when you're clear about your authentic values and desires. The energy here points toward relationships built on mutual respect, shared dreams, and the kind of emotional safety that allows both partners to flourish.
Professionally, the Ten of Cups indicates work that aligns with your deeper values and contributes to your overall life satisfaction. This might mean finding a career that feels meaningful rather than just financially rewarding, or discovering ways to bring more harmony between your work and personal life. You may be part of a team that feels like family, or working in an environment where collaboration and mutual support are genuinely valued. This card can also signal success in family businesses or ventures that serve your community in meaningful ways.
Spiritually, the Ten of Cups represents the integration of your inner work with your outer relationships. This card suggests that your spiritual growth is manifesting as greater capacity for love, compassion, and authentic connection. You may be discovering how your personal healing contributes to the wellbeing of your community, or finding spiritual meaning in your role as caregiver, partner, or friend. The card points toward a mature spirituality that embraces both personal growth and service to others.
When the Ten of Cups appears reversed, it often points to discord within your closest relationships or a sense that your values are misaligned with your current circumstances. You might be experiencing tension in your family or feeling disconnected from the people who matter most to you. This card reversed can indicate that surface harmony is masking deeper issues that need attention, or that you're settling for relationships that don't truly nourish your soul. Sometimes this energy suggests that your pursuit of the perfect family or relationship dynamic has become rigid or unrealistic, preventing you from appreciating the imperfect but genuine connections available to you. In career contexts, reversed Ten of Cups may signal work environments that feel toxic or misaligned with your values, creating stress that ripples into your personal life. The card can also indicate that you're prioritizing external achievements over emotional wellbeing, leading to a sense of emptiness despite apparent success. This reversal invites you to examine what authentic happiness means to you and whether your current path is truly serving your deeper needs for connection and fulfillment.

While the Nine of Cups represents personal satisfaction and getting what you want, the Ten of Cups focuses on shared happiness and community fulfillment. The Nine is about individual contentment, while the Ten is about creating lasting joy through meaningful relationships and family bonds. The Ten represents a more mature, sustainable form of happiness that includes others.
